import math
import numpy as np
from collections import Counter
import pandas as pd
import dask.dataframe as dd
import dask.array as da
NUMBER_OF_TOP_POPULAR_PRODUCTS = 6000
MOVING_WINDOW_SIZE = 4
REMEMBER_WINDOW_SIZE = 4
MOVING_WINDOW_SKIP_SIZE = 1
def load_data():
return pd.read_csv(
"./data/input.csv", encoding="utf-8", dtype=str, na_values="null"
)
def extract_raw_sessions(raw_data):
raw_sessions = []
for x in raw_data["product_sequence"].iteritems():
raw_sessions.append(x[1].split(","))
return raw_sessions
def get_popular_products(raw_sessions):
products_all_occurrences = [x.strip() for y in raw_sessions for x in y if x.strip()]
products_ordered_by_occurrences = sorted(
Counter(products_all_occurrences).most_common(NUMBER_OF_TOP_POPULAR_PRODUCTS),
key=lambda x: (x[1], x[0]),
reverse=True,
)
popular_products = [x[0] for x in products_ordered_by_occurrences]
return popular_products
def create_product_ids_masking(popular_products):
return {product: index for index, product in enumerate(popular_products)}
def create_product_ids_masking_reversed(popular_products):
return {index: product for index, product in enumerate(popular_products)}
def encode_sessions(product_ids_masking, raw_sessions):
encoded_sessions = [
[
product_ids_masking.get(x)
for x in item
if product_ids_masking.get(x) is not None
]
for item in raw_sessions
]
return encoded_sessions
def get_valid_sessions(encoded_sessions):
# Sequence of 1 doesn't have a target ;)
return [x for x in encoded_sessions if len(x) > 1]
def extract_sequences_vs_targets(encoded_sessions):
# Extract sequences and targets
sequences_vs_targets = []
# Only keep the x latest items that can fit in the REMEMBER_WINDOW_SIZE
number_of_latest_items_to_fetch = MOVING_WINDOW_SIZE + (
(REMEMBER_WINDOW_SIZE - 1) * MOVING_WINDOW_SKIP_SIZE
)
for session in encoded_sessions:
targets = session[1:]
intervals = []
for index, target in enumerate(targets):
base = session[: index + 1][-number_of_latest_items_to_fetch:]
len_base_minus_window_size = len(base) - REMEMBER_WINDOW_SIZE
number_of_active_remember_windows = (
math.ceil(len_base_minus_window_size / MOVING_WINDOW_SKIP_SIZE) + 1
)
if number_of_active_remember_windows < 1:
number_of_active_remember_windows = 1
sequences = [
base[i : i + MOVING_WINDOW_SIZE]
for i in range(number_of_active_remember_windows)
]
sequences = ([[]] * (REMEMBER_WINDOW_SIZE - len(sequences))) + sequences
intervals.append(sequences)
sequences_vs_targets.append([intervals, targets])
# print(sequences_vs_targets)
return sequences_vs_targets
def encode_binary(sequences_vs_targets):
# binary encoding
OUTPUT_PROCESSING_CHUNK_SIZE = 10000
number_of_sequences = len(sequences_vs_targets)
chunks = [
sequences_vs_targets[x : x + OUTPUT_PROCESSING_CHUNK_SIZE]
for x in range(0, number_of_sequences, OUTPUT_PROCESSING_CHUNK_SIZE)
]
for count, sequences_targets_sliced in enumerate(chunks):
combined_X = []
combined_y = []
for X, y in sequences_targets_sliced:
number_items = len(X)
X_ = np.zeros(
(number_items, MOVING_WINDOW_SIZE, NUMBER_OF_TOP_POPULAR_PRODUCTS),
dtype=bool,
)
y_ = np.zeros((number_items, NUMBER_OF_TOP_POPULAR_PRODUCTS), dtype=bool)
for index, (x_indexes, y_index) in enumerate(zip(X, y)):
y_[index][y_index] = 1
for interval_index in range(MOVING_WINDOW_SIZE):
X_[index][interval_index][x_indexes[interval_index]] = 1
combined_X.append(np.copy(X_))
combined_y.append(np.copy(y_))
del X_
del y_
dataset_X = np.vstack(combined_X)
dataset_y = np.vstack(combined_y)
return dataset_X, dataset_y
def main():
raw_data = load_data()
print(raw_data.head())
raw_sessions = extract_raw_sessions(raw_data)
popular_products = get_popular_products(raw_sessions)
popular_products_encoded = list(range(NUMBER_OF_TOP_POPULAR_PRODUCTS))
product_ids_masking = create_product_ids_masking(popular_products)
product_ids_masking_reversed = create_product_ids_masking_reversed(popular_products)
# encoding
encoded_sessions = encode_sessions(product_ids_masking, raw_sessions)
encoded_sessions = get_valid_sessions(encoded_sessions)
sequences_vs_targets = extract_sequences_vs_targets(encoded_sessions)
X, y = encode_binary(sequences_vs_targets)
print(f"length of X and y: {len(X)}, {len(y)}")
print("end")
return X, y
if __name__ == "__main__":
main()
